For the 2025 school year, there are 118 public middle schools serving 66,459 students in Alameda County, CA. The top ranked public middle schools in Alameda County, CA are Yu Ming Charter, William Hopkins Middle School and Cottonwood Creek. Overall testing rank is based on a school's combined math and reading proficiency test score ranking.
Alameda County, CA public middle schools have an average math proficiency score of 41% (versus the California public middle school average of 32%), and reading proficiency score of 53% (versus the 46% statewide average). Middle schools in Alameda County have an average ranking of 9/10, which is in the top 20% of California public middle schools.
Minority enrollment is 87% of the student body (majority Hispanic), which is more than the California public middle school average of 78% (majority Hispanic).
